Social Connectedness

Social Connectedness measures the extent to which an expression reflects having, maintaining, or exerting ties with other people and social systems. It encompasses interpersonal contact, relationship presence, participation in shared networks, and active linkage through influence or exchange.

Minimal Social Connectedness
Expressions activating this band refer mainly to practical, procedural, or general life circumstances, with only incidental mention of other people or relationships. Social ties are backgrounded rather than described as an active source of contact, belonging, or influence.
Low Social Connectedness
Expressions activating this band describe limited but recognizable interpersonal contact, such as contact with a partner, neighbors, or everyday social interactions. The connection is present as access, proximity, or occasional relational experience rather than as broad embeddedness in a network.
Moderate Social Connectedness
Expressions activating this band describe being linked to others through ongoing roles, opportunities for communication, partnership participation, or influence in shared decisions. Connectedness appears as active involvement in relational or group contexts rather than simple contact alone.
High Social Connectedness
Expressions activating this band describe dense, consequential ties marked by networking, recognized connections, and socially embedded positions that link people across organizational or relational settings. Connectedness is experienced as a salient web of relationships with practical reach.
Intense Social Connectedness
Expressions activating this band describe highly consequential relational linkage through formal relationships, transfers, transactions, or cross-setting exchanges that depend on established ties. Connectedness is expressed as durable, instrumental relationship structure with substantial social reach.
